Control arms, also known as "A arms," are important parts of the front suspension on your Audi car or SUV. They connect the frame or body to the wheel assembly. Some models have two control arms, while others have four -- two upper and two lower. When any of them fail, you're in for quite a rough ride. Audi Control Arms FAQ

What Do Audi Control Arms Do?

One end of a control arm connects to the chassis, where bushings limit vibration and noise while reducing any metal-on-metal contact. The other end connects to the steering knuckle by way of a ball joint. That allows your wheels to enjoy smooth movement in every direction.

What Are The Types of Audi Control Arm Assemblies?

Control arms are connected through bolt in, unitized, or press in assemblies. MacPherson struts typically features bolt-in assemblies. Unitized and press in assemblies both integrate with a ball joint, so you'll need to replace the whole assembly when you're replacing one. That's usually an easier job than it is to replace a bolt-in assembly.

How Do You Recognize Failing Control Arms?

Even the best control arms can wind up going bad, whether due to age or rough road conditions. Signs of problems include:

  • Loss of control
  • Your Audi drifts when you brake or go over uneven terrain
  • Uncomfortable ride quality
  • Popping or clunking sounds
  • Uneven tire tread wear

How Much Does An Audi Control Arm Replacement Cost?

On average, you can expect to pay between $220 and $530 for parts alone. That varies, of course, based on the size of your vehicle and where you're having the work done. Keep in mind that labor can add another $150 to $200 to that amount.
